Aegirbio signs agreement with Salofa for the veterinary market and receives a first order worth approximately SEK 2 million.

With this agreement, AegirBio will, via its subsidiary Magnasense Technologies OY, sell its existing MagniaReader to Salofa, which will bring it to market with proprietary tests for horses, dogs and cats. Magnasense receives revenue from the sale of instruments and royalties on the disposable products ie. tests that Salofa sells for the instruments.

When the contract was signed, an order was added to the value of 195,000 Euro (approx. SEK 2 million) for year one.
